
The Journal of Neurotrauma
The Journal of Neurotrauma is a scientific publication that shares research about brain and spinal cord injuries. It publishes studies on how these injuries happen, how they can be treated, and how recovery can be improved. The journal aims to advance medical knowledge and help healthcare professionals develop better ways to diagnose, manage, and prevent neurotrauma. It serves researchers, clinicians, and specialists working in neuroscience, rehabilitative medicine, and related fields to stay informed about the latest discoveries and innovations in injury care.
